PowellsWood Garden – First a7RIV Outing

Long story short, I sold off my a9 and Sony branded lenses. Then, I picked up a used a7R IV to use with my Zeiss Loxia lenses – the only remaining lenses I own for the FE mount.

This was my first outing with this camera, and I paired it with the 25mm Loxia. Sony’s sensors are amazing – great dynamic range and colors!!! Of all the Zeiss Loxia lenses, the 25mm is definitely my favorite.
